Windshield Washer Jet tubes?
Weird question, but...
I got my ZC swap done. It runs, it's beautiful, I love it
However, I cannot find one of the windshield washer lines that I took off the hood before pulling the old motor - I've reattached the driver's side, but the passenger side, I can't find the tube. There's a tube that runs alongside the driver's side tube, but it goes into the firewall just below the injector resistor box, and as far as I can tell, it's supposed to - it seems to go into a fitting. But I can't find anything else that would hook up into the passenger side jet.

the tube that comes from the firewall goes to the fluid bottle. another tube comes out of the bottle and splits into the two squiters.

If you need the actual hose you can get replacement ones at any hardware store. Just go in there and get that surgical elastic type hoses. We did this when my buddy somehow lost his on his truck. They fit fine and work great. Just make sure you know how big diameter you need before you buy.

Thanks, guys! It looks like I've got 31, but need 10, 28, and 30. Out of curiousity, what does the tube coming from the firewall actually do? I mean, the motor is at the bottle, the fluid, obviously, is at the bottle, what's the point of the tube there?
Im pretty sure that will run to the rear washer. As far as tubing is concerned, just go to wally world and get some of that tubing for fish aquariums, im pretty sure its the same size, and its pretty damn cheap.
